On March 29, 1790, John Tyler was born, in a place called Charles City County (His future presidential competition, William Henry Harrison, also came from here). But I am running out of time, so I am gonna skimp over the next few years. Tyler was elected for governor of Virginia in 1825 by a landslide (131–81). Three years later, after much pestering by his fellow Democrat–Republicans, he sought a seat in the senate, and won by 5. He then resigned his governorship. He later (again) gave up his seat in 1836 in order to avoid complying with the Virginia legislature's instructions in order to reverse the censure vote. At this point in time, he became affiliated with the Whigs. Finally, we are at his presidency (sorta). We are in 1840, and the whigs selected Tyler as the vice president nominee with William Henry Harrison running for president. They won, but around a month later, WHH died. 2 days after, on April 4th, 1841, Tyler (finally) became the president!!!
